Premier League: Chelsea vs. Newcastle United - Preview
Chelsea will be aiming to salvage a disappointing Premier League season on a positive note as they host Newcastle United at Stamford Bridge on Sunday afternoon.
Currently sitting in 12th place, the Blues face the possibility of dropping as low as 14th depending on the final matchday results, while Newcastle has secured a top-four finish, trailing third-placed Manchester United by two points.
Chelsea Preview
Chelsea's season took another blow on Thursday evening as they suffered their 16th league defeat, a 4-1 loss to Manchester United at Old Trafford. Despite Joao Felix's late consolation goal, Frank Lampard's side had already suffered a 4-0 defeat before the Portuguese forward found the net.
Undeniably, it has been a disastrous campaign for the Blues, winning just 11 out of 37 league matches, drawing 10, and losing 16. Their tally of 43 points is only enough to secure a 12th-place finish heading into the final fixtures.
While a victory over Newcastle could see them surpass Crystal Palace to claim 11th place, a defeat coupled with other unfavorable results could push them down to 14th, adding insult to injury.
Preparations for next season are already underway, with Mauricio Pochettino set to take over as head coach, replacing interim manager Lampard. Since returning to the club following Graham Potter's departure, Lampard has managed just one win, one draw, and eight defeats in 10 games.
With no European football on the horizon, a win on Sunday would provide some solace to the fans. Notably, Chelsea has not dropped points against Newcastle at home in the Premier League since May 2012.
Newcastle Preview
Newcastle's place in next season's Champions League was secured with a goalless draw against Leicester City. It has been an impressive campaign for Eddie Howe's side, accumulating 70 points from 37 matches and currently sitting in fourth place, trailing Manchester United by two points.
To claim a top-three finish, Newcastle needs a victory against Chelsea and hopes that Manchester United falters against Fulham at home.
Having last competed in the group stage of the Champions League in 2003, Newcastle's involvement in Europe's premier competition will undoubtedly attract higher caliber players, making the upcoming transfer window an intriguing period for the club.
Despite their successful season, Newcastle has only managed one win in their last four league matches. In their most recent away game on May 13, they were held to a 2-2 draw by Leeds United.
Newcastle secured a 1-0 victory over Chelsea at St James' Park in December, and they will be aiming to achieve their first league double over the London side since the 1986-87 campaign. However, Newcastle has only emerged victorious once in their last 27 visits to Stamford Bridge in the Premier League.
